Mourning the Passing & Celebrating the Spirit of Holly Schneider

5/4/2014

3 Comments

 
I am mourning the loss of Holly Schneider, whom Ivy and I met about 10 years ago when she was our teacher for Music Together. Later, when I was pregnant with Gemma, we gave Holly a copy of my book Birds & Fancies. It's always a stretch to offer up poetry. 
Holly and I ran into each other from time to time over the years and her bright, warm spirit was always a joy to encounter. She and my kids' dad, Paul, shared the easy affinity of musicians.
Then last year, she invited me to work with her on literary programming at Studio Grand...to bring my new project, Lark, into collaboration with hers. We discovered all sorts of commonalities in our lives and in our hopes. She was in the midst of creating such a beautiful space that integrated all of her previous work into something that was -- and is -- a beautiful, welcoming, gift to the community here in Oakland -- to all of our multiple communities and to our common humanity.
The trust, conversation, and encouragement she extended toward me in creating the Lark reading series in her space is indicative of her generosity and vision for the space.
I will really miss her.
